The
activating transcription factor 1
(
AP-1
) family of proteins consists of a large number of inducible factors that are implicated in many biological processes, including cellular and viral gene expression, cell proliferation, differentiation, and tumorigenesis. Here, we investigated the role of the
AP-1
family members
c-Jun
and c-Fos in transcriptional regulation of the JC virus (JCV) promoter in glial cells. DNA binding studies demonstrated the specific association of
c-Jun
with its DNA sequences corresponding to the
AP-1
site within the JCV promoter. Functional analysis of the promoter showed that ectopic expression of
c-Jun
and c-Fos results in an additive activation of the JCV early and late promoters. Further functional assays indicated that the JCV
AP-1
binding site is sufficient to confer responsiveness to both
c-Jun
/c-Fos- and UV-induced activation when transposed to a heterologous promoter. Analysis of
c-Jun
expression during the viral infection cycle by Western blotting revealed that
c-Jun
is posttranslationally modified by phosphorylation and its protein level is substantially increased at the late phases of infection cycle. Altogether, our findings indicate that
AP-1
family members may play a role in the pathogenesis of JCV-induced disease in the human brain by modulating JCV gene transcription.
